Social media practices can facilitate new forms of collaborative knowledge construction. It encourages civic engagement in broader communities of practice. Establishing a level of trust within a social group can make the learning process more effective.

Mobile learning – a form of elearning that is accessed by a mobile device such as smart phone or tablet; can be anywhere, anytime. Coaching – a relationship in which a trained coach helps an employee develop the knowledge and skills to be a more effective manager by addressing real situations that manager faces in workplace.
